Barbara Schett produced another good display at the Madrid Open to reach the semi-finals by beating 4th seed and last year's French Open semi-finalist Clarissa Fernandez
Schett who hasn't had a good year by her standards only won her first match since January two weeks ago seems to be getting back to her old form. The Austrian's power from the back of the court was far too much for the Argentine succuming to a 6-2, 6-3 loss.
Iroda Tulyaganova from Uzbekistan enjoyed a win over Cara Black the conquerer of Conchita Martinez 7-5, 6-4 to also advance into the semi's.
Chanda Rubin's poor clay season seems to be on the up when she thrashed Paola Suarez 6-2, 6-4. Rubin was a beaten finalist last year to Monica Seles.
